President Zardari to Award Arshad Nadeem Hilal-e-Imtiaz

Advertisement

President Asif Ali Zardari has announced that Arshad Nadeem will be honored with the Hilal-e-Imtiaz for his historic gold medal win at the Paris Olympics. The directive has been communicated to the cabinet division.

On Friday, the National Assembly also passed a resolution unanimously to award Nadeem in recognition of his remarkable javelin throw, which set an Olympic record with a distance of 92.97 meters and ended Pakistan’s 32-year Olympic medal drought.

The resolution commended Nadeem’s achievement and recommended that President Zardari bestow the civil award. The motion received full support in the assembly.

Nadeem’s success has also led to a surge in his social media following, with 460,000 new Instagram followers gained in less than two days.

Upon his return to Pakistan, Senate Deputy Chairman Syedaal Khan Nasar plans to host an honorary dinner for Nadeem. Additionally, Sindh government spokesperson and Sukkur Mayor Barrister Arsalan Islam Sheikh announced that Nadeem will be presented with a gold crown in Sukkur, and a new sports stadium in the city will be named “Arshad Nadeem Stadium” in his honor.
